Wealthy Chinese investors are once again turning their gaze toward Singapore, reversing a recent exodus as regulatory scrutiny and global geopolitical instability intensify.
Beijing’s tightening grip on offshore assets, combined with mounting international volatility, has sharply diminished the appeal of rival financial centers across Europe and North America.
Consequently, the Lion City’s robust legal framework and trusted neutrality are swiftly re-establishing it as the premier wealth sanctuary for Asia's ultra-rich elite.
